Description
Hiring for 3 month, 5 month and 11 month positions. The Management Section of the Wildlife Division is primarily responsible for implementation of habitat development and restoration efforts on public Wildlife Management Areas and conducting wildlife population surveys along with disease and depredation response.

Examples of Work
Assist with prescribed burning, ground preparation and plantings, weed control, repair and maintain equipment, be a team leader, mix and apply chemicals, word processing, age and check deer, perform wildlife surveys, handle depredation response, public relations, oversee contractors and assist with wildlife disease investigations. Possible non-traditional work week hours and some weekends.

Qualifications / Requirements
REQUIREMENTS: 12 semester hours or the equivalent of post high school coursework/training in fisheries management, natural resources and/or biology OR 6 months experience in wildlife/recreation or fisheries management. Driver's license required.

PREFERRED: Applicants with Pesticide Applicators license and Class A CDL license with O endorsement

Knowledge, Skills and Abilities
Knowledge of and ability to operate tractors, All Terrain Vehicles (ATV's), chainsaws, and other farm equipment; basic knowledge of wildlife management principles. Computer skills (MS Word, Access, Excel) highly desirable.
